USNA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

188 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Usana Health Sciences (USNA)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$1.19B — down 18% from $1.46B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 38 funds closed out of USNA and 36 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 53 trimmed existing stakes and 72 added.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$28.2M. The largest seller was TIAA CREF Investment Management, cutting an estimated $16.8M.
